    The global green data center market size was estimated at approximately USD 53 billion in 2023, and it is projected to reach an impressive USD 145 billion by 2032,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 12%. This robust growth is driven by increasing demands for energy-efficient infrastructure, coupled with heightened regulatory pressures to reduce carbon footprints across all industries. As organizations worldwide become more environmentally conscious, the adoption of green data centers is becoming an essential component of their corporate social responsibility strategies. These centers help in minimizing energy consumption and greenhouse gas emissions, while simultaneously lowering operational costs through innovative cooling solutions and sustainable energy sources.



    One of the primary growth drivers for the green data center market is the escalating environmental concerns and regulatory mandates that push for energy-efficient solutions. Governments and environmental bodies across the globe have been introducing stringent regulations regarding energy consumption and carbon emissions, which has prompted organizations to shift towards sustainable data center solutions. Moreover, the rising cost of electricity and the increasing demand for data storage and processing power are encouraging companies to adopt innovative solutions that enhance energy efficiency. This trend is further fueled by advancements in technology that enable the deployment of high-performance, energy-efficient computing equipment, reducing the environmental impact of data centers.



    Another significant factor contributing to the market's growth is the rapid digitization and increasing reliance on cloud services, big data, and IoT applications. As businesses continue to digitize their operations, the demand for data centers has surged, necessitating greater storage capacities and efficient data management solutions. Green data centers, with their sustainable energy usage and reduced carbon footprints, provide the ideal solution for companies looking to align their technological growth with environmental sustainability. Furthermore, the use of renewable energy resources, such as solar and wind power, is becoming increasingly common, allowing data centers to operate with minimal impact on the environment while also providing cost savings in energy expenditure.



    The emergence of innovative cooling technologies, such as liquid cooling and free cooling, also plays a pivotal role in the growth of the green data center market. Traditional data centers are often burdened with high energy costs due to inefficient cooling systems. However, advances in cooling technologies have significantly reduced energy consumption, enabling data centers to operate more sustainably. Organizations are increasingly adopting these advanced solutions to optimize their energy consumption and reduce their environmental impact. Additionally, the incorporation of AI and machine learning technologies to monitor and manage data center operations has further enhanced efficiency, enabling predictive maintenance and optimizing energy usage.



    Regionally, North America is expected to hold a substantial share of the green data center market, driven by early technology adoption and strong regulatory frameworks promoting sustainability. Europe follows closely, with the EU's stringent environmental policies providing a robust impetus for the development of green data centers. The Asia Pacific region is anticipated to witness the fastest growth over the forecast period, due to significant investments in IT infrastructure and increasing awareness of environmental sustainability. In contrast, the Middle East & Africa and Latin America are gradually emerging markets, with growing awareness and adoption of green practices in the data center industry, albeit at a slower pace compared to their global counterparts.

    London had a reported 265 megawatts (MW) of data center capacity under construction as of the second half of 2024, the most of any European market. The British capital also had the most capacity planned, ahead of Frankfurt and Dublin. The FLAPD markets dominate the European data center industry The data center markets of Frankfurt, London, Amsterdam, Paris, and Dublin, collectively referred to as FLAPD, are the key hubs powering the 98 billion euro European market. London is the largest of these markets, with its total inventory of almost 1,000 MW placing it second only to Northern Virginia in global rankings. While land and energy availability in the London area pose challenges, many investors are willing to pay the price for proximity to a global commercial hub. Sustainability tops the agenda Efficiency and sustainability have become key concerns in the European market, with expanding data center facilities proving a significant drain on local infrastructure. The European Union has looked to take a leading role in this regard, seeking to grow the region’s green data center market. In addition, EU legislation adopted in 2024 requires the publication of key performance metrics in order for operators to be rated against sustainability criteria.

    Europe Green Data Center Market Drivers

    1. Initiatives in Regulation and Policy Pact for Climate Neutral Data Centers: By 2030, more than fifty cloud and data center providers have committed to becoming climate neutral. This covers pledges for water conservation, server recycling, heat reuse, energy efficiency, and 100% renewable energy consumption. Expulsion from the accord may result from noncompliance.​

    European Green Deal: The shift to sustainable digital infrastructure is being expedited by the EU's overarching objective of becoming climate-neutral by 2050.​

    1. Growing Energy Requirements for Cloud and AI Services According to the International Energy Agency, AI workloads might cause the world's data center electricity usage to more than double by 2030. In order to control expenses and emissions, this spike is forcing operators to implement energy-efficient and renewable-powered solutions.

Recent developments include: February 2023: The French data center company Data4 announced plans for a new site in Hanau, Germany, on the site of a former army barracks in Hanu, east of Frankfurt. Previously, the GIC-backed European logistics real estate company P3 Logistic Parks had announced a large data center campus on this site. Data4 revealed plans for a sizable data center park after purchasing the roughly 20-hectare site from P3. Data4 intends to develop a campus of its data centers., January 2023: CyrusOne acquired an office complex in Frankfurt, Germany, with plans to turn it into a data center campus. The investment group Corum sold the Europark office complex in Frankfurt for EUR 95 million (USD 102.3 million) before confirming that CyrusOne was the buyer. Recent developments include: September 2022: Bulk announced several expansion initiatives at its Norwegian data center locations, with investments focused on ensuring long-term power and land availability. Highly connected and scalable sites powered by 100% renewable energy are provided. With many European locations battling with power restrictions and increasing demand for data center capacity, Bulk completed the installation of the N01 onsite substation, which provides 125 MVA of dual connections to the adjacent Kristiansand substation., September 2022: Stack Infrastructure successfully connected an Oslo data center to the local district heating system four years after DigiPlex began the project. The OSL01 data center has been linked to Hafslund Oslo Celsio's district heating system in the Norwegian capital. Following a one-year ramp-up period, waste heat from the facility is now expected to provide heat and hot water for up to 5,000 houses..
